正面描述 At left, a portrait vignette of Sheikh Mujibur Rahman (17 March 1920 – 15 August 1975), the founding Father of the Nation and first leader of independent Bangladesh, popularly titled 'Bangabandhu' (Friend of Bengal). The central vignette presents the National Martyrs' Memorial (জাতীয় স্মৃতি সৌধ) at Savar, the national monument erected in honour of those who fell during the 1971 Bangladesh War of Independence. Inscriptions in Bengali and numerals identify the issuing authority and denomination, with guilloche underprint patterns throughout.
正面铭文 登录 以查看详情
背面描述 The central vignette presents the Sixty Dome Mosque (ষাট গম্বুজ মসজিদ) in Bagerhat, the largest surviving mosque from the Bengal Sultanate period (1204–1576), constructed by Ulugh Khan Jahan and recognised as part of a UNESCO World Heritage Site. The architectural composition conveys the monument's characteristic multiple domes and arched facade. Inscriptions in Bengali and English identify the structure and denomination, flanked by guilloche border elements.
